Try the Radisson. A few weeks ago we paid $119 for four people, including parking for the week, a shuttle to and from the cruise terminal and a wonderful buffet breakfast for two. Great hotel, with beautiful pool and tiki bar.

Vee, the beach area is a REAL beach. http://messages.cruisecritic.com/infopop/emoticons/icon_smile.gif Here's a webcam not too too far from the resort:
http://www.twopalms.com/
Now, the thing is we really couldn't SEE the beach from Cape Caribe. At least not from any of the places we were. I did see the walkway that leads from the resort towards the beach, but we didn't go down it since we have been to that beach many times. (We actually went over to watch the cruise ships sail out of port that day and went early to look at Cape Caribe.) Maybe if your room is high enough up (and facing the right direction), you can see the ocean, but I don't know.
It is definitely not within walking distance to the port. If you are familiar with the area, the entrance to the resort is just before the Jetty Park entrance. Port Canaveral is actually pretty big, and there is an out-of-commission cruise ship (Ocean Cruise Lines' Mirage, I believe) docked very close to the entrance to Cape Caribe. You can probably see the other cruise ships in the distance from the entrance to Cape Caribe, and maybe from some of the higher rooms.

hello, just returned from canaveral yesterday. we stayed at the best western oceanfront. if u call the 800# ask for the managers special, u can get a btter rate. ours was 89 for sat and 79 for sun. the lobby is on A1A the pool is between 2 bw buildings. nice pool/bar. it was fine, but not much around. the pier was a 5 minute walk. restaurants and bars a few junk shops. closes at 11 pm. took cab to rustys at the port to watch the boats come and go. if u go to cocoabeach.com, u can find alot of hotels. bw lets u leave your car for free, so does comfort suites. some even offer shuttles to the ship. there is a hotel called the fawltey towers right by ron jon. and winn-dixe, walgreens, subway, beach wear shops, and is a block walk to the beach. we took a cab from ron jon back to bw for 3.40.
